    17  package test
    18  
    19  import (
    20  	"os"
    21  	"path/filepath"
    22  	"testing"
    23  
    24  	kubeadmapi "k8s.io/kubernetes/cmd/kubeadm/app/apis/kubeadm"
    25  	kubeadmconstants "k8s.io/kubernetes/cmd/kubeadm/app/constants"
    26  	certtestutil "k8s.io/kubernetes/cmd/kubeadm/app/util/certs"
    27  	configutil "k8s.io/kubernetes/cmd/kubeadm/app/util/config"
    28  	"k8s.io/kubernetes/cmd/kubeadm/app/util/pkiutil"
    29  )
    30  
    31  // SetupTempDir is a utility function for kubeadm testing, that creates a temporary directory
    32  // NB. it is up to the caller to cleanup the folder at the end of the test with defer os.RemoveAll(tmpdir)
    33  func SetupTempDir(t *testing.T) string {
    34  	tmpdir, err := os.MkdirTemp("", "")
    35  	if err != nil {
    36  		t.Fatalf("Couldn't create tmpdir")
    37  	}
    38  
    39  	return tmpdir
    40  }
    41  
    42  // SetupEmptyFiles is a utility function for kubeadm testing that creates one or more empty files (touch)
    43  func SetupEmptyFiles(t *testing.T, tmpdir string, fileNames ...string) {
    44  	for _, fileName := range fileNames {
    45  		newFile, err := os.Create(filepath.Join(tmpdir, fileName))
    46  		if err != nil {
    47  			t.Fatalf("Error creating file %s in %s: %v", fileName, tmpdir, err)
    48  		}
    49  		newFile.Close()
    50  	}
    51  }
    52  
    53  // SetupPkiDirWithCertificateAuthority is a utility function for kubeadm testing that creates a
    54  // CertificateAuthority cert/key pair into /pki subfolder of a given temporary directory.
    55  // The function returns the path of the created pki.
    56  func SetupPkiDirWithCertificateAuthority(t *testing.T, tmpdir string) string {
    57  	caCert, caKey := certtestutil.SetupCertificateAuthority(t)
    58  
    59  	certDir := filepath.Join(tmpdir, "pki")
    60  	if err := pkiutil.WriteCertAndKey(certDir, kubeadmconstants.CACertAndKeyBaseName, caCert, caKey); err != nil {
    61  		t.Fatalf("failure while saving CA certificate and key: %v", err)
    62  	}
    63  
    64  	return certDir
    65  }
    66  
    67  // AssertFilesCount is a utility function for kubeadm testing that asserts if the given folder contains
    68  // count files.
    69  func AssertFilesCount(t *testing.T, dirName string, count int) {
    70  	files, err := os.ReadDir(dirName)
    71  	if err != nil {
    72  		t.Fatalf("Couldn't read files from tmpdir: %s", err)
    73  	}
    74  
    75  	countFiles := 0
    76  	for _, f := range files {
    77  		if !f.IsDir() {
    78  			countFiles++
    79  		}
    80  	}
    81  
    82  	if countFiles != count {
    83  		t.Errorf("dir does contains %d, %d expected", len(files), count)
    84  		for _, f := range files {
    85  			t.Error(f.Name())
    86  		}
    87  	}
    88  }
    89  
    90  // AssertFileExists is a utility function for kubeadm testing that asserts if the given folder contains
    91  // the given files.
    92  func AssertFileExists(t *testing.T, dirName string, fileNames ...string) {
    93  	for _, fileName := range fileNames {
    94  		path := filepath.Join(dirName, fileName)
    95  
    96  		if _, err := os.Stat(path); os.IsNotExist(err) {
    97  			t.Errorf("file %s does not exist", fileName)
    98  		}
    99  	}
   100  }
   101  
   102  // AssertError checks that the provided error matches the expected output
   103  func AssertError(t *testing.T, err error, expected string) {
   104  	if err == nil {
   105  		t.Errorf("no error was found, but '%s' was expected", expected)
   106  		return
   107  	}
   108  	if err.Error() != expected {
   109  		t.Errorf("error '%s' does not match expected error: '%s'", err.Error(), expected)
   110  	}
   111  }
   112  
   113  // GetDefaultInternalConfig returns a defaulted kubeadmapi.InitConfiguration
   114  func GetDefaultInternalConfig(t *testing.T) *kubeadmapi.InitConfiguration {
   115  	internalcfg, err := configutil.DefaultedStaticInitConfiguration()
   116  	if err != nil {
   117  		t.Fatalf("unexpected error getting default config: %v", err)
   118  	}
   119  	return internalcfg
   120  }
